Netstat close_wait过多
WebJul 9, 2024 · 值 得一说的是,对于基于TCP的HTTP协议,关闭TCP连接的是Server端,这样,Server端会进入TIME_WAIT状态,可 想而知,对于访 问量大的Web Server,会存在 … Web一般来讲我们首先会排查 CPU 方面的问题。CPU 异常往往还是比较好定位的。原因包括业务逻辑问题(死循环)、频繁 GC 以及上下文切换过多。 而最常见的往往是业务逻辑(或者框架逻辑)导致的,可以使用 jstack 来分析对应的堆栈情况。 ①使用 jstack 分析 CPU 问题
Netstat close_wait过多
Did you know?
WebTCP-IP详解:Delay ACK. Nagle算法为了避免网络中存在太多的小数据包,尽可能发送大的数据包。. 定义为在任意时刻,最多只有一个未被确认的小段。. 小段为小于MSS尺寸的数据块,未被确认是指数据发出去后未收到对端的ack。. Nagle算法是在网速较慢的时代的产物 ... WebTIME-WAIT. 为了解决网络的丢包和网络不稳定所带来的其他问题,确保连接方能在时间范围内,关闭自己的连接. 如何查看TIME-WAIT状态的链接数量? netstat -an grep TIMEWAIT wc -l 查看连接数等待timewait状态连接数. 为什么会TIME-WAIT过多?解决方法是 …
WebOct 11, 2024 · 1.服务器保持了大量TIME_WAIT状态. 2.服务器保持了大量CLOSE_WAIT状态,简单来说CLOSE_WAIT数目过大是由于被动关闭连接处理不当导致的。. 因为linux分配给一个用户的文件句柄是有限的,而TIME_WAIT和CLOSE_WAIT两种状态如果一直被保持,那么意味着对应数目的通道就一直被 ... Webcpio-550 多个 Linux 命令,内容包含 Linux 命令手册、详解、学习,值得收藏的 Linux 命令速查手册。
Web这一次重启真的无法解决问题了:一次 MySQL 主动关闭,导致服务出现大量 CLOSE_WAIT 的全流程排查过程。 近日遇到一个线上服务 socket 资源被不断打满的情况。通过各种工具分析线上问题,定位到问题代码。这里对该问题发现、修复过程进行一下复盘总结。 先看两张图。 WebMar 24, 2024 · 1. time_wait过多 1.1原因. 首先,产生time_wiat是主动关闭链接的一方(课本上以客户端讲解)。. 其次,产生过多time_wait最典型的是通信双方使用短链接。. 服务 …
WebMar 24, 2024 · LINUX下解决netstat查看TIME_WAIT状态过多问题netstat -an awk ‘/tcp/ {print $6}’ sort uniq -c 16 CLOSING130 ESTABLISHED298 FIN_WAIT1 13 FIN_WAIT2 9 …
WebAug 24, 2024 · 现象:netstat查看很多CLOSE_WAIT,造成日志提示Too many open files错误,ssh远程不上去,很多服务报错,响应不了请求。解决思路:1、首先确 … infant program near meWebdeclare-550 多个 Linux 命令,内容包含 Linux 命令手册、详解、学习,值得收藏的 Linux 命令速查手册。 infant programs minneapolisWeb二、TIME_WAIT 过多的危害. 占用端口资源 :客户端(主动关闭连接)的 TIME_WAIT 状态过多,客户端都是跟一样的「目的 IP:PORT 」的服务端建立连接,当客户端的 TIME_WAIT 状态连接过多,无效占用的端口也过多,端口资源是有限的,一般可以开启的端口为 15000~60000 ... infant programs nycWebHBase CLOSE_WAIT产生原因:HBase数据以HFile形式存储在HDFS上,这里可以叫StoreFiles,HBase作为HDFS的客户端,HBase在创建StoreFile或启动加载StoreFile时创建了HDFS连接,当创建StoreFile或加载StoreFile完成时,HDFS方面认为任务已完成,将连接关闭权交给HBase,但HBase为了保证实时响应,有请求时就可以连接对应数据 ... infant programs tyler txWeb二、TIME_WAIT 过多的危害. 占用端口资源 :客户端(主动关闭连接)的 TIME_WAIT 状态过多,客户端都是跟一样的「目的 IP:PORT 」的服务端建立连接,当客户端的 … infant program victoriaWebLAST_ACK:等待所有分组死掉. 如果目前内核中存在大量处于TIME_WAIT状态的socket,那么说明这些socket还没有被释放掉,它们还占用着资源,这样就有可能导致操作系统的负载过高,怎么解决这个问题呢?. 通过调整内核参数来解决:. 增加如下内容:. 执行下 … infant programs near meWebNov 30, 2024 · 一、“多半是程序的原因”?这个还是交给程序猿吧二、linux 下 CLOSE_WAIT过多的解决方法情景描述:系统产生大量“Too many open files” 原因分 … infant progress by month